Vacancy expired!
A client of Insight Global is looking to add a Lead Back End .NET Developer to their team! This role will be 60-70% technical responsibilities, 30-40% team leadership responsibilities (You will be interfacing heavily with architects, attending architect review boards, identifying gaps to communicate requirements back to the development teams)
Cosmo or MongoDB (Mongo is currently used by the team) experience
Experience with Aerospike
Advanced knowledge and experience with GraphQL
Expertise in one of the following:
8+ years of working experience with C# and .NET Framework (looking for .NET Core or .NET 5) or Java / Spring Boot Framework. Experience in designing and building of event driven microservices
8+ years of experience with TSQL and relational database systems and an expert in working with NoSQL and Key-Value Database systems such as Redis
Expert knowledge with event platforms such as Kafka and modern messaging systems
5+ years of experience with HTML5, JavaScript/TypeScript, CSS
5+ years of demonstrated experience with any of the modern JavaScript libraries such as React (would be preference), Angular, VueJS
Expert with Unit Testing Libraries / Frameworks
Expert with RESTful Service patterns and Reactive technologies
Hands on experience in applying design patterns, writing unit tests, and optimizing performance in application level.
Experience with one or more advanced programming constructs such as multi-threaded programming, dependency injection, database design, and performance optimization
Disciplined self-starter, capable of working independently and in close collaboration within an Agile development team.
Excellent communication, documentation, and collaboration skills.
Leadership/mentorship qualities and an eagerness to fine-tune those skills